You probably overlooked this, I did, Dry Cleaners all have large air compressors.
After driving through the one I use many times I finally noticed he had three out back with only one working, on my next
trip I went inside and ask the owner about the other two, he said they were broken!, I picked them up for 400 bucks.
Got my trailer, loaded them up and took them to a local air compressor shop where I made a deal, I would give them one of the compressors if they would rebuild the other, done deal, they were both good quality cast iron, 220V, twin cylinder.
10 years later and still going strong.
